Customer communications absolute nightmare the whole process from beginning to end was horrendous. Your returns policy is the by far the worst and most stressful process I have ever experienced would never buy another rug from you that is for sure
4 months ago
benuta.co.uk has a
4.2
average rating
from
438
reviews